Output 68a598b39df560134817324d8a9bb61be32b0a16f48c249cd61d3a7d9aa35ef5:0

value
484000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ec764900649dc00e9c6dfba52be4de5eaa245ac OP_EQUAL
address
37QxgVaAi6UnA2ewbJHjw5n4Gh86DfsHjj
transaction
68a598b39df560134817324d8a9bb61be32b0a16f48c249cd61d3a7d9aa35ef5
spent
true